Here's another record from Ubisoft, the cleverness of their support. This is the way to solve all the login connection problem so many suffered recently:

"To resolve you issue could you please uninstall the Uplay launcher from your PC.

Could you please go to http://uplay.ubi.com/en-GB and click on the link to download and then reinstall the launcher.

Once the Uplay client is reinstalled please do the following:-

Go to the following location - C:\Program Files (x86)\Ubisoft\Ubisoft Game Launcher

- Right click Uplay.exe

- Select properties

- Switch to the compatibility tab and tick run this program as an administrator.

- Click Apply and then OK.

Once you have done this please try to run the game again."

Dragon Age: Origins 1.02
------------------------

Many of the fixes affecting balance, gameplay, or plot scripting are already
included in the Xbox 360 and PlayStation®3 versions of Dragon Age: Origins.

BALANCE
- Daggers now apply 0.5 points of damage per additional point in dexterity and
0.5 points of damage per additional point in strength, as originally intended.
This increases dagger damage for high-dexterity characters.
- During combat, mana or stamina reserves now correctly regenerate more quickly
when reserves are low. This allows players to occasionally use an talent or
spell in the later stages of lengthy fights.
- When exploring, mana and stamina now regenerate more quickly at higher
character levels. This reduces downtime between fights.
- The spells Force Field, Crushing Prison, Cone of Cold, and Blizzard now have
shorter durations and/or longer cooldowns. This ensures that combatants can no
longer stun-lock each other by repeatedly casting the same spell.
- The cooldowns for several low-level sustained abilities are now shorter. This
ensures that players are not penalized for accidentally deactivating them.
- Certain battles were not scaling properly, resulting in excessively difficult
fights. They now scale as intended.
- Enemy corpses now drop health poultices and money more appropriately,
resulting in less clutter in the player's inventory.

GAMEPLAY
- In rare cases, enemy corpses were selectable when they contained no loot.
This no longer occurs.
- Party members whose combat tactics were set to defensive behavior no
longer stop attacking after using a spell or talent.
- In rare cases, combat tactics conditions could fail to determine whether a
character had enough mana or stamina to use an ability. This no longer occurs.
- The Rally talent no longer repeats its audio effect if it is active during
certain conversations.
- The Rally talent no longer deactivates upon area transitions or conversations.
- The Shimmering Shield spell now deactivates when the character is out of mana.

PLOT (SPOILER WARNING)
- Promotional downloadable content items now remain in the player's inventory
when standard items are removed at the end of the dwarf noble origin.
- Repeatedly talking to Duncan after gathering the vials in the Korcari Wilds
but not the treaties no longer provides duplicate experience.
- Leliana's personal plot can now be completed if the player substantially
increased her approval (through gifts) before talking to her.
- During the siege of Redcliffe, enemies are no longer able to spawn in
locations that would break the plot.
- Bann Teagan no longer disappears when he is supposed to be accessible during
Urn of Sacred Ashes.

PC-SPECIFIC
- Controlling a summoned creature (like a ranger's pets) during certain special
area transitions no longer results in odd behavior.
- Creating a character in a custom module did not create a folder for saves.
This could result in corruption of main campaign saves. This no longer occurs.
- In some cases, the class icon was set incorrectly for characters imported
from the downloadable Character Creator. This no longer occurs.
- The options menu now includes a setting to automatically download previously
purchased content that is not currently installed.
- After installing new downloadable content, the game now always reminds the
user to restart the game.
- The icons for some promotional downloadable content items were missing. They
now appear correctly.
- Various issues could occasionally cause uploads to the online player profile
to fail unexpectedly. This no longer occurs.
